Cancels the user interaction. Call this method to cancel interaction, usually in response to the user clicking the right mouse button while dragging. |
|
![]() |
Invoked to commit the changes made by the user. |
|
![]() |
Checks whether the current interaction can be completed at the specified point. |
|
![]() |
This method is invoked in the beginning of the interaction, usually when the user presses the left mouse button over a modification handle. |
|
![]() |
This method is invoked to update the interaction state, usually in response to the user moving the mouse after the modification has started. |
